The City of Greer has announces a new recreational facility to be built as part of the forGreer initiative.
The new facility off of Highway 14 was announced as part of the city’s forGreer project at a press conference Thursday morning.
Greer Mayor Rick Danner explained that the $60 million complex is vital to the growing Greer community, which he said is lacking in similar spaces.
He continued to explain that the facility will be able to serve as a venue for regional and national events as well to bring economic growth to the region through tourism.
The center will include space for volleyball and basketball courts, community rooms, an e-sports facility, and batting cages. It’s expected to be completed within the next four to five years.
